Course details

• Power and Space: Architectures of Control and Resistance
• The City as a Political Project: Urban Planning and Social Justice
• Representations of Power: Ideology and Architectural Form
• Architecture, Memory, and Collective Identity
• The Ethics of Design: Sustainability and Social Responsibility
• Architecture and the Body: Habitation and Experience
• Critical Theories of Architecture: Deconstruction and Postmodernism
• The Politics of Preservation: Heritage and the Built Environment
• Globalisation and Architectural Practice

Career path

Career Role Description
Architectural Historian (Political Philosophy Focus) Researching the political ideologies embedded in architectural design throughout history. Strong research, writing and analytical skills are vital for academic and consultancy roles.
Urban Planner (Political Economy & Design) Developing urban strategies considering social equity, economic viability, and environmental sustainability. Requires strong planning, policy analysis, and stakeholder management skills.
Architectural Critic (Political & Social Commentary) Analyzing buildings and urban environments through a political and social lens, engaging in public discourse. Critical thinking, writing, and communication skills are paramount.
Policy Advisor (Built Environment & Politics) Advising government and organizations on policy affecting the built environment. Strong policy understanding, negotiation, and political acumen are essential.
Sustainability Consultant (Political & Ethical Dimensions) Assessing and improving the environmental and social impact of building projects, considering ethical and political implications. Expertise in sustainability principles and policy is necessary.
